Managing Reservations Shares

Shared reservations support two or more reservations occupying the same room.  When the Enforce Same Stay Dates For Sharing Guests OPERA Control is not active, shared reservations are not required to share the same arrival and departure dates, but must share at least one night in common. When the Enforce Same Rate Code For Sharing Guests OPERA Control is not active, shared reservation can have different rate codes and package entitlements. Share reservation can be setup so that one reservation has the entire rate or each reservation may share a portion of the rate amount.

Unlike the Accompanying Guests feature, each share reservation has separate billing and folio details. You can combine existing reservations into a share reservation and add a new reservation to create a share. 

Adding New Share Reservation

  1. From the OPERA Cloud menu, select Bookings, select Reservations, and then select Manage Reservation.

  2. Enter search criteria for the reservation and click Search.

  3. Select a reservation in the search results, click I Want to. . . and then select Shares or click the Shares link in Reservation Presentation.

  4. Click Create New Share and enter the following details:

    1. Name: Click to search for a profile or create a profile.

      1. Click Create Guest Profile to create a new profile. Refer to Creating Guest or Contact Profile.

    2. Adults: Enter the number of adults.

    3. Children: Enter the number of children.

    4. Arrival: Enter or select the arrival date.

    5. Departure: Enter or select the departure date.

    6. Reservation Type: Select a reservation type from the list.

    7. Enter Payment Information.

      1. Refer to Managing Reservation Payment Instructions.

  5. Click Save.

  6. Refer to Adjusting Share Rates below.

Combining Existing Reservations into a Share Reservation

 To combine existing reservations there must be at least night of the stay in common.

  1. From the OPERA Cloud menu, select Bookings, select Reservations, and then select Manage Reservation.

  2. Enter search criteria for the reservation and click Search.

  3. Select a reservation in the search results, click I Want to. . . and then select Shares or click the Shares link in Reservation Presentation.

  4. Click Combine Existing Reservation.

    1. Name: Enter surname of the reservation and click the icon to search.

    2. Select the reservation in the search result and click Select.

  5. Click Save.

  6. Refer to Adjusting Share Rates below.

Separating (Breaking) Share Reservations (Reserved Status)

  1. From the OPERA Cloud menu, select Bookings, select Reservations, and then select Manage Reservation.

  2. Enter search criteria for the reservation and click Search.

  3. Select a reservation in the search results, click I Want to. . . and then select Shares or click the Shares link in Reservation Presentation.

  4. Select the reservation(s) to be separated and click the vertical ellipsis and select Separate Share.

Note:

When the Enforce Credit Card Entry for Credit Card Guaranteed During Break Share OPERA Control is active a list of credit card guaranteed reservations which does not have credit card details will be presented in addition to the payment screen to enter new credit card details to be attached to those reservations.

Separating (Breaking) Share Reservations (Inhouse Status)

For Inhouse reservations use the Room Move action to separate share reservations.

  1. From the OPERA Cloud menu, select Bookings, select Reservations, and then select Manage Reservation.

  2. Enter search criteria for the reservation and click Search.

  3. Select a reservation in the search results, click I Want to. . . and then select Shares or click the Shares link in Reservation Presentation.

  4. Select the reservation(s) to be separated and click the vertical ellipsis Actions menu and select Room Move. For more information, see Room Move.

Adjusting Shared Rates

  1. From the OPERA Cloud menu, select Bookings, select Reservations, and then select Manage Reservation.

  2. Enter search criteria for the reservation and click Search.

  3. Select a reservation in the search results, click I Want to. . . and then select Shares or click the Shares link in Reservation Presentation.

  4. Click the vertical ellipsis and select on the following options:

    1. Apply Full Rate: Select this option to apply the rate in full to each sharing guest.

    2. Apply Entire Rate: Select this option to apply the rate in full for the total number of persons to the first share reservation. First select the reservation for which the entire rate is to be applied.

    3. Apply Split Rate: Select this option to split the rate evenly between all sharing guests.

    4. Apply Custom Split Rate: Select this option to apply a custom split rate between all sharing guests.

      1. For each date and each reservation enter the rate amount

      2. For eligible rate codes you can also enter a discount amount per night and select a discount reason from the list.

      3. Click Save.

  5. Refer to Fixed Rate Share Considerations below.

Fixed Rate Share Considerations

This section describes OPERA Cloud shares handling for fixed rate reservations.

When the Share Rate Splitting for Fixed Reservations OPERA Control is inactive the following conditions apply when a sharer has a fixed rate:

  • The sharer cannot be designated to pay the full rate (Full option). The sharer pays the fixed rate, regardless of whether it is more or less than the full rate.

  • The sharer cannot be designated to assume the total rate charge using the Entire option. Neither will the rate for the sharer be set to zero if another sharer is chosen to assume the total room rate charge. The rate for this sharer remains at the fixed rate.

  • If the Split option is selected, the fixed rate will not change for the sharer. The fixed rate will be used as this sharer's portion of the split, and other sharers will equally divide the remainder of the rate. For example, assume a three-way share, with Guest 1, having a fixed rate of 145. If the total rate for the night is 450, the Guest 1 share is 145, while the other two guests split the remainder (305), paying 152.50 each.

When the Share Rate Splitting for Fixed Reservations OPERA Control is active the Entire, Full, and Split options are available and behave the same as for non-fixed rates, provided that:

  • All sharer reservations have a fixed rate.

  • All sharer reservations have the same rate code.

OPERA Cloud simply adds the fixed rates shown on the reservations. The rate amounts are added together each time Full is selected.

For example, assume that Guest 1, Guest 2 and Guest 3 are sharing, that all three have the same rate code, and all three have a fixed rate.

  • OPERA Cloud simply adds the fixed rates shown on the reservations. The rate amounts are added together each time Full is selected. For example, if one sharer has a fixed rate of 140 and another has a fixed rate of 145, the rate for each sharer will be 285 when Full is selected. If Full is selected again, the rate for each sharer will be 570. The rate is not refreshed (for example, to account for a 3-adults rate that may be specified on the rate detail).
